We've been tracking Video Game and Video Game Accesssory prices at Best Buy, Game Stop, Amazon, Buy.com, Newegg, Walmart, Target, and a few others. What we noticed is that when those stores mark down video game consoles or accessories, so does Amazon. Not only do they usually match the price, but Amazon tries to drop a dollar or two to make you feel good about yourself Savvy Shoppers.
